摘要: 针对多产品采购条件下的可持续供应商选择问题,基于可持续供应商的经济绩效、环境绩效和社会绩效构建评价指标体系,提出一种两阶段供应商选择模型。第一阶段对候选供应商的环境绩效和社会绩效进行资格审查;第二阶段评价经过资格审查的供应商的经济绩效,根据核心企业对供应商数量的要求给出不同的决策方法。该模型要求各决策专家利用传递信息更为丰富、计算更为准确的可能性分布—犹豫模糊语言集(PD-HFLTS)表征评价信息,并给出一种群体一致性检验与调整算法以克服异常值的影响。针对传统层次分析法中专家不易给出大量两两指标对比的偏好信息,利用最佳—最差权重确定方法确定指标相对重要度。通过案例分析论证了所提模型的可行性与有效性。

Abstract: Sustainable supplier selection plays an important role in the construction of sustainable supply chain.With respect to sustainable supplier selection under multi-products purchases,a novel evaluation index system of supplier selection was proposed based on economic performance,environmental performance and social performance of sustainable supplier.Then the two-stage supplier selection model was proposed.In the first phrase,the candidate suppliers meeting the basic requirements of environmental performance and social performance was selected.In the second phrase,the different decision-making methods were proposed based on the requirements of core enterprise for the number of suppliers through the evaluation of qualified candidate suppliers' economic performance.In the model,Possibility Distribution-Hesitant Fuzzy Linguistic Term Set (PD-HFLTS) was utilized to characterize the evaluation information with the advantage of more information contained and more accurate calculation,and then the group consensus checking and adjusting algorithm was given to overcome the the effect of outliers.Aiming at the problem that it was not easy for experts to give the preference information of pairwise comparison with a large number of the indices,the Best Worst Method (BWM) based on PD-HFLTS was proposed to solve the problem,and then a novel consistency checking and adjusting algorithm was proposed.The feasibility and effectivity of the model was illustrated by the example of sustainable supplier selection of an automobile seat manufacturer with four kinds of raw materials purchases.
